Abstract
A mobile terminal comprising a main housing, first and second sub-housings, each slidably mounted on an upper surface of the main housing such that the first and second sub-housings can slide towards each other or away from each other to open or close a predetermined region of the upper surface of the main housing, and a sliding module. The mobile terminal is structured such that the display apparatus can be opened or closed by the first and second sub-housings, and such that it is easy to operate keypads with both hands when the display apparatus is open, resulting in convenience of playing games or chatting. Additionally, the sliding module of the mobile terminal is structured such that the first and second sub-housings are interlinked with each other, which allows for easy opening and closing of the display apparatus.
